“The Last Olympian” ─ A Summary
“The Last Olympian,” the fifth and final book in Rick Riordan’s original Percy Jackson & the Olympians series, plunges directly into the heart of the looming war between the gods and the titan Kronos. With Olympus directly threatened and Manhattan becoming the battleground, Percy Jackson, now sixteen, must confront his destiny and lead the demigods in a desperate defense.
The story unfolds as Kronos’s army invades New York City, forcing Percy and his friends to fight alongside each other, and even some unexpected allies, to protect the city and the gods’ home. Internal conflicts and betrayals add layers of complexity as Percy grapples with prophecies and the weight of his responsibility.
Ultimately, the fate of the world rests on Percy’s shoulders as he faces Kronos in a climactic showdown. The novel explores themes of courage, loyalty, sacrifice, and the importance of embracing one’s identity. Key Characters in “The Last Olympian”

Percy Jackson, the central protagonist, continues his journey as a powerful demigod, grappling with prophecies and his connection to the sea god, Poseidon. Annabeth Chase, his intelligent and strategic girlfriend, plays a crucial role in planning the defense of Olympus and offering unwavering support.
Grover Underwood, Percy’s loyal satyr friend, provides comic relief and essential assistance, navigating the mortal world and offering insights into the natural world. Luke Castellan, a former friend turned enemy, embodies the tragic figure of Kronos’s vessel, driving much of the conflict.
Nico di Angelo, the son of Hades, undergoes significant development, confronting his past and embracing his powers. Clarisse La Rue, a fierce and determined warrior, leads the charge in several key battles. Chiron, the centaur trainer, provides guidance and wisdom to the demigods. The gods themselves, though distant, are actively involved, influencing events and offering assistance – or hindering progress – based on their own agendas. The Central Conflict: The Battle of Manhattan
The Battle of Manhattan forms the explosive climax of “The Last Olympian,” as Kronos’s army launches a full-scale assault on Mount Olympus, now located atop the Empire State Building. Demigods, led by Percy Jackson, desperately defend the city and the gods’ home from monstrous forces.
This conflict isn’t merely a physical war; it’s a struggle for the future of the Olympian gods and the balance between the mortal and immortal worlds. Percy must rally his allies, including the demigods of Camp Half-Blood, to hold off the Titan army while simultaneously confronting his own destiny.

Major Plot Points and Story Arcs
“The Last Olympian” features several interwoven plot points. Percy’s sixteenth birthday prophecy looms large, revealing his potential to save or destroy Olympus. The search for Typhon, a monstrous giant, becomes critical as Kronos intends to use him as a weapon. Meanwhile, the demigods prepare for the inevitable siege of Manhattan, fortifying their defenses and training for battle.

A key arc involves Nico di Angelo’s journey to understand his powers and his connection to the underworld. Another focuses on Annabeth Chase’s strategic brilliance as she designs the defense of Manhattan. Copyright and Legal Considerations
Downloading and distributing unauthorized PDF copies of “The Last Olympian” raises significant copyright concerns; Rick Riordan’s work is protected by international copyright laws, granting exclusive rights to the author and publisher regarding reproduction and distribution. Obtaining a PDF through unofficial channels, such as websites offering “free downloads,” constitutes copyright infringement, a legally punishable offense.
While the concept of “fair use” exists, it generally doesn’t extend to downloading entire books for personal use. Fair use typically applies to limited excerpts for purposes like criticism, commentary, or education.
